Carles Cufi 41f1f648f6 west: runners: Guess build folder
When using a build folder format with build.dir-fmt that includes any
parameters that need resolving, the west runners cannot find the folder
since the required information (board, source dir or app) is not
available.
Add a very simple heuristic to support the case where a build folder
starts with a hardcoded prefix (for example 'build/') and a single build
is present under that prefix.
The heuristic is gated behind a new configuration option:
build.guess-dir

This directory contains implementations for west commands which are
tightly coupled to the zephyr tree. Currently, those are the build,
flash, and debug commands.

Before adding more here, consider whether you might want to put new
extensions in upstream west. For example, any commands which operate
on the multi-repo need to be in upstream west, not here. Try to limit
what goes in here to just those files that change along with Zephyr
itself.

When extending this code, please keep the unit tests (in tests/) up to
date. You can run the tests with this command from this directory:

$ PYTHONPATH=$(west list --format="{abspath}" west)/src:$PWD py.test

Windows users will need to find the path to .west/west/src in their
Zephyr installation, then run something like this:

> cmd /C "set PYTHONPATH=path\to\.west\west\src:path\to\zephyr\scripts\west_commands && py.test"

Note that these tests are run as part of Zephyr's CI when submitting
an upstream pull request, and pull requests which break the tests
cannot be merged.
